‘This Is Coming to This Country’: Kara Swisher Warns Italy’s Anti-LGBTQ Parenting And Surrogacy Law Will Come to U.S.

Tech journalist Kara Swisher made an ominous prediction recently on her Pivot podcast regarding the future of LGBTQ rights in the U.S.

Swisher and co-host Scott Galloway regularly end their episodes with predictions and Swisher went first at the end of last week, saying, “I’m going to make a very short one.”

“Italy just passed an anti-surrogacy law, and it’s very much aimed at gay men having children and taking away parental abilities for gay people, not women. Many of them have uteruses, but and can’t be stopped from having children, although maybe that’s also in the offing there,” Swisher said, adding:

This is coming to this country, this kind of attitude towards, you know, everyone’s like, don’t panic. When we all said Roe v. Wade is going to get overturned, it means like you’re over you know, you’re being dramatic. Nobody was dramatic dramatically saying this. I listen to what the evangelicals say and the right and they are very much against gay marriage, gay parenting.

“If you really cared about families and wanted more kids, you’d put more money in the pockets of young people. 60% of able-bodied Americans age 30 to 34, used to have at least one child. Now it’s 27%. And I don’t think it’s because they’re turned off of kids. I think it’s because they don’t have the money,” replied Galloway.

After a back and forth on the topic, Swisher noted, “Let me be clear about that. By the way, on this bill, it already extends a practice inside the country to also include those who seek it out in places where it is legal, such as the U.S. or Canada. So they can’t travel or they have, there’s prison two years in prison and fines. And again, Giorgia Meloni can go fuck herself.”
